Your DMA settings are perfect.
If you've no need for Roxio then you might as well uninstall it. It has quite a reputation for interfering with other burning apps and could possibly be causing your errors. Here's a great utility to remove the little bits that get left behind after the standard uninstall:
http://softwareupdates.roxio.com/gm/support/tools/roxizap.exe
Are you running the latest firmware for your Sony?

Many programs that access a CD/DVD drive need a ASPI Layer as it's I/O interface. The errors you are receiving seem to indicate that yours is missing or damaged and needs to be replaced. Removing Roxio and using Roxizap may have done that. More info at the ForceASPI 1.8 site.
Other programs like DVD Decrypter can use many different I/O interfaces.
http://forums.afterdawn.com/thread_view.cfm/104533
IMAPI CD burning service should be disabled. It is Windows built in CD recording software, but it is not very good and can cause problems for other recording software.
